In 1935, swing music captured the hearts of the nation, with Benny Goodman rising to fame as the king of swing and a beloved matinee idol. Amid the struggles of the Depression, Americans were eager to escape their worries through dance. "Swing: Pure Pleasure" explores the ongoing journeys of Goodman, Artie Shaw, and Louis Armstrong, while also highlighting the emergence of the incredible Billie Holiday.
